Apthorp Care Centre is a specialist care home in Barnet, North London supporting adults with complex nursing needs, dementia and mental health conditions. The home offers 119 purpose designed bedrooms across three floors and provides complex nursing care, specialist dementia support and residential mental health care within a safe, structured and supportive environment focused on dignity, stability and wellbeing.

The Role
As Clinical Deputy Manager, you will support the Home Manager in leading the clinical team and ensuring the delivery of high quality care for residents with complex nursing needs, dementia and mental health conditions.

You will oversee clinical care delivery across the service, supporting nurses and care staff to ensure safe medication management, accurate care planning and effective monitoring of residents’ health and wellbeing.

Your role will involve supporting clinical governance, supervising the nursing team, responding to changes in residents’ health and working closely with multidisciplinary professionals to ensure the best possible outcomes for residents.

As part of a specialist complex care service, you will help establish strong clinical systems and ensure care is delivered in a safe, structured and therapeutic environment.

What We Are Looking For

  • Registered Nurse (RGN or RMN) with active NMC PIN
  • Experience working in complex nursing, dementia or mental health care settings
  • Previous leadership or senior nursing experience
  • Strong clinical knowledge and decision making skills
  • Excellent communication and team leadership abilities

About Us
Apthorp Care Centre is part of Willinbrook Healthcare, the specialist complex care division of Care Concern Group. Willinbrook Healthcare delivers high quality, clinically led care for adults with complex physical and mental health needs across specialist services. Care Concern Group is a family owned, market leading care provider with over 130 homes across the United Kingdom, committed to delivering outstanding care and creating supportive workplaces where teams can grow and flourish.
